
Joaquín Galán
Joaquín Galán is a celebrated musician and the other half of the renowned Argentine duo Pimpinela, which he forms with his sister Lucía. The pair is famous for their theatrical performances and emotional songs that have resonated with fans across generations. They will be returning to Lima, Peru, for their tour 'Noticias del amor,' showcasing their greatest hits in honor of Mother's Day.
